Player Profile
Campbell was a local player born in Bootle who signed as professional for the club in November 1950 when he was 18-years-old. A youth international defender, he didn't get any first-team opportunities until the 1953/54 relegation season, one of an astonishing 31 players called on by manager Don Welsh during that traumatic year. Campbell had to wait for a change of manager to get a decent run in the team and he appeared in 28 games under the leadership of Phil Taylor in the 1957/58 season. He was however transferred to fourth division Crewe Alexandra in the summer. He made 169 appearances for Crewe before signing for fourth division Gillingham in 1962. He moved to non-league Folkestone in 1964 where he spent three years and then settled in at Margate where he played 99 games as right-back and on occasion in midfield, while working as a painter and decorator. On 10th September 2016, Liverpool FC's official website carried an article saying he had died that week.
